METHODOLOGY Intersection LOS Methodology. The Trciffix (Version 7.9) computer software was utilized to determine the level of serv ice (LOS) at signalized study area intersections based on the Intersection Capacity Utilization (ICU) methodology. Consistent with Cit>' requirements, the ICU methodology compares the volume-to-capacity (v/c) ratios of conflicting turn movements at an intersection, sums these critical conflicting v/c ratios for each intersection approach, and determines the overall ICU. The resulting v/c is expressed in terms of LOS. w here LOS A represents free-flow activity and LOS F represents overcapacity operation. LOS is a qualitative assessment of the quantitative effects of such factors as traffic volume, roadway geometries, speed, delay , and maneuverability on roadway and intersection operations. LOS Description A. No approach phase is fully utilized by traffic, and no vehicle waits longer than one red indication. Typically, the approach appears quite open, turns are made easily, and nearly all drivers fmd freedom of operation. B. This service level represents stable operation, where an occasional approach phase is fully utilized, and a substantial number are nearing full use. Many drivers begin to feel restricted within platoons of vehicles. C. This level still represents stable operating conditions. Occasionally, drivers may have to wait through more than one red signal indication, and backups may develop behind turning vehicles. Most drivers feel somewhat restricted, but not objectionably so. D. This level encompasses a zone of increasing restriction approaching instability at the intersection. Delays to approaching vehicles may be substantial during short peaks within the peak period; however, enough cycles with lower demand occur to permit periodic clearance of developing queues, thus preventing excessive backups. E. Capacity occurs at the upper end of this service level. It represents the most vehicles that any particular intersection approach can accommodate. Full utilization of every signal cycle is attained no matter how great the demand. F. This level describes forced flow operations at low speeds, where volumes exceed capacity. These condhions usually result from queues of vehicles backing up from a restriction downstream. Speeds are reduced substantially, and stoppages may occur for short or long periods of time due to the congestion. In the extreme case, speed can drop to zero. The relationship between LOS and the ICU value (i.e.. v/c ratio) is as follows: LOS Intersection Capacitv Utilization A <0.60 B >0.6i and < 0.70 C >0.71 and < 0.80 D >0.81 and < 0.90 E >0.91and< 1.00 1 F > 1.00 The City considers LOS D to be the maximum acceptable LOS al all intersections. A project would cause a significant impact if the project causes the LOS to deteriorate to LOS E or F, or if the project adds more than 2 percent (0.02) to the ICU for an intersection already operating at LOS E or F. Peak-Hour Link Analysis Methodology. A detailed peak-hour link analysis was prepared to determine LOS at the study area roadway segment. This directional peak-hour analysis assumes a lane capacity of 1.800 vehicles per hour per lane based on the San Diego Traffic Engineers' Council/ Institute of Transportation Engineers (SANTECTTE) requirements. For roadway segments, LOS D (i.e.. v/c = 0.90) will be the maximum acceptable LOS. PROJECT CONDITIONS Trip Generation, Trip Distribution and Assignment This analysis considers the development of a Residential Bum Prop Facility, a Commercial Bum Prop Facility, and a Public Safety Facility. The daily and peak-hour trips for the project were generated based on discussions with City Police and Fire Department staff. Police Department use of the safety facility only will have no more than six vehicles on site. Four 12-hour shifts begin at 4:00 and 6:00 a.m. and at 4:00 p.m. and 6:00 p.m. In addition. 8-hour administration shifts begin at 8:00 a.m. and end at 5:00 p.m. Operational hours for the shooting range vary from 8:00 a.m. to 4:00 p.m. and may potentiallv be open to outside groups w ith a maximum of 20 vehicle trips. The Fire Department operates a 24-hour shift with approximateK 20 vehicles starting at 7:30 a.m. Fire classes ('7 31/0)^ .iP •RrX;nSi:i"l\CirCLilaii(>n Memo: doo LSA ASSOCIATES, INC. forthe Burn Prop Facility \ ary from 8:00 a,m. to 5:00 p.m. and will generate a total of 30 vehicle trips. Table C (attached) shows the proposed trip generation for the project. As the table indicates, the Fire Administration/Support and Shooting Range/Classroom Facilities are forecast to generate 'approximately 104 daily trips, including 27 trips during the a.m. peak hour and 30 during the p.m. peak hour. The Residential and Commercial Bum Facilities are forecast to generate approximately 170 daily trips, including 70 trips during the a.m. peak hour and 35 during the p.m. peak hour. The proposed facility is forecast to generate at total of approximately 274 trips per day, including 97 trips in the a.m. peak hour and 65 trips in the p.m. peak hour. The trip generation table was reviewed by City staff and approved on May 14, 2008. Project trip distribution for the proposed project was based on expected travel patterns between the project and local and regional destinations. Figure 4 illustrates the project trip distribution. Approximately 50 percent of the project trips are destined to the south via El Camino Real and Orion Street; 30 percent are destined to the north via El Camino Real: and 10 percent are destined to the east and west via Faraday Avenue. MITIGATION MEASURES No significant impacts have been identified. Therefore, no mitigation measures are required. CONCLUSIONS Based on the results of this limited traffic impact analysis, the Joint First Responders Training Facility can be implemented without significantly impacting the surrounding roadway system during existing conditions. Evaluation of intersection and roadway LOS shows that the addition of project traffic to the baseline traffic volumes will not impact any study area intersections or roadways. As a result, no mitigation measures are required.
